63 12 870 Replacing ignition unit for xenon headlight (with xenon bulb)

WARNING: Version with xenon headlights: Danger to life due to high voltage! Therefore, before removing, disconnect all components from the voltage supply (lighting system and ignition off).
Work on the entire xenon lighting system (control unit, ignition unit with bulb) may only be carried out by qualified personnel.
Follow instructions for HANDLING LIGHT BULBS (EXTERIOR LIGHTS) .
IMPORTANT: Ignition unit and xenon bulb are viewed as a single component and must not be separated.

Before replacing the ignition unit with the xenon bulb the power permitted for the relative type of headlight needs to be checked! 

An exterior distinguishing feature are burls (1) on the lens (2) of the retrofit xenon headlight Retrofit xenon headlights are equipped with xenon bulb D5S 12V 25W (LWR and SRA not prescribed).

Retrofit xenon headlights are equipped with xenon bulb D5S 12V 25W (A) (LWR and SRA not prescribed).

Standard xenon headlights are equipped with xenon bulb D1/D1S 12V 35W (B) (LWR and SRA prescribed).

Unlock retaining tab (1) and remove protective cap (2) from headlight.

Installation note: 

Protective cap (2) must be correctly engaged.

Check seal.

Replace protective cap (2) if necessary.

Comply with INSTRUCTIONS FOR REPLACING THE PROTECTIVE CAP .

Unlock wire spring clips (1).

Disconnect plug connection (2).

Remove ignition unit for xenon headlight (3) from headlight.

Installation note: 

Make sure ignition unit (3) is exactly seated in headlight.

Recommendation:

Check HEADLIGHT ADJUSTMENT , correct if necessary.
